Step 1: Arrival and Assessment
We’ll arrive at your property, equipped with the necessary gear to assess the situation. Our technicians will identify the source of the water and find out the best course of action. We’ll get to work right away to reduce further damage.
Step 2: Water Removal
Our team will use advanced equipment to extract water from your property. We’ll use a combination of pumps and vacuums to remove standing water and prevent further damage. We’ll work efficiently to get your property dry and safe.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water’s removed,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ying your property.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th. We’ll get your property dry and safe in no time.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Our team will sanitize and disinfect your property to prevent the growth of bacteria and mold. We’ll use eco-friendly products to ensure your property’s safe and healthy. We’ll leave your property feeling fresh and clean.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ration
Once the sanitizing and disinfecting process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property’s safe and secure. We’ll work with you to restore your property to its former glory. We’ll make sure you’re happy with the final result.

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ak (less than 1 inch) |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small leaks,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Large water leak (over 1 inch) | No | Yes | Large leaks need profess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Standing water over 2 inches deep | No | Yes | Standing water over 2 inches deep needs profess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and mold growth. |
|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g., electrical room) | No | Yes | Water damage in sensitive areas needs professional exp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Water damage caused by a natural disaster | No | Yes | Water damage caused by a natural disaster needs professional expertise and equipment to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Water damage in a crawl space or attic | No | Yes | Water damage in crawl spaces or attics needs professional expertise and equipment to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ost In Wilmer, TX
The cost of Emergency Water Removal (24/7) in Wilmer, TX, var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can help you plan for your emergency. Don’t let cost hold you back our team offers free estimates and flexible payment options to ensure you get the help you need.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Final inspection and restoration |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Emergency water removal (24/7)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| More services (e.g., mold remediation) |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
